Transaction 4096d589131ef0927aa40cab2286ac1f831a8dcce6c9739318bb1abd9337150e
1 Input
1 Output
-
4096d589131ef0927aa40cab2286ac1f831a8dcce6c9739318bb1abd9337150e:0
- value
- 1340727
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66a8abc124169766377611c2efa73078da6c7d80 OP_EQUAL
- address
- 3B3pua5b2Lm5McMb9nUbMimeuhD7CTPJjM